Job Overview Join Poly Coatings team as a Metal Plating Process Technician! In this vital role, you will be responsible for executing and monitoring metal plating processes that enhance the durability, appearance, and functionality of various components. Your inputs will ensure that plating operations run smoothly, safely, and efficiently, contributing to the production of high-quality finished products. This position offers an exciting opportunity to work with advanced plating technologies in a fast-paced environment where precision and attention to detail are paramount. Responsibilities Prepare and set up plating tanks according to specified process parameters. Monitor plating processes throughout production runs, ensuring consistent quality and adherence to safety standards. Conduct regular inspections of plated parts for defects, uniformity, and adherence to specifications. Maintain detailed records of quality checks for traceability and compliance purposes. Troubleshoot equipment issues promptly to minimize downtime and optimize process efficiency. Follow all safety protocols related to chemical handling, waste disposal, and equipment operation to protect yourself and your team. Collaborate with quality control teams to implement improvements and resolve any plating-related issues swiftly. Qualifications Prior experience in metal finishing or manufacturing is highly preferred but not mandatory. Understanding of manufacturing processes, process controls, and safety procedures related to plating operations. Ability to read technical diagrams, process specifications, and safety data sheets with ease. Excellent attention to detail with a focus on producing high-quality finished products. Good communication skills for documenting processes and collaborating with team members. Physical ability to handle high value materials, operate equipment safely, and perform routine inspections in a manufacturing setting. Willing to cross train for supporting processes.
